McCreesh departs NY Times for NY Magazine

Shawn McCreesh

Shawn McCreesh is joining the New York Magazine as a features writer covering media, politics and power, reports Politico.

Recently, he was an editorial assistant to New York Times’ Maureen Dowd.

Previously, McCreesh was also an editorial assistant at Men’s Journal magazine at Wenner Media and was an editorial intern at Rolling Stone Magazine. He has also interned at amNewYork.

McCreesh has a B.S. in journalism from St. John’s University.
